LOL, yesterday's gay gossip columnist at the Invader ("Adrian DeWitt") is a very obvious riff on George Sanders' famous character Addison DeWitt from All About Eve. Far from subtle, but it's fun and I don't mind. It's not as obnoxious as the constant in-jokes and references RC used to throw in. (I remember when his film/art references were more quiet and obscure, like the Alec Guinness classic The Horse's Mouth or when he quietly had Shane on OLTL - who the network had vetoed making gay - go off to the "Phil Jimenez Art School" in London, Phil Jimenez being a gay comic artist.)
